Transaction dd22335f70e4859d9c8164178824318e7fa40bc7577730fa38b4f709eefd715b

1 Input
1 Outputs
  • dd22335f70e4859d9c8164178824318e7fa40bc7577730fa38b4f709eefd715b:0
  • value  118596
    address  3MqfSeQhC36HeD5KMhvu6fMPY1M2xndH4a